    Decisions .300 blackout Vs. 6.5 Grendal

    Ok my dad is wanting to get another AR stye rifle. i told him to go with somthing besides the .223 and .308 since i have both of theose. its come down to the 6.5 and the 300 black out. what are yalls thoughts? not opossed to anything else also so chime in.

    #2
    Good luck is all that comes to mind. Both are great cartridges. If you're wanting to add a suppressor I'd say go with the .300 aac blackout so you can shoot .300 whisper the sub sonic loading.

            #6
            Either are going to be tough to find right now. If you want to stretch it out a ways, 6.5. If your distances are going to be under 200yds and you're ever considering a suppressor, 300.
